Post edited 11:20 am – April 11, 2009 by Watchful


Bronze

Classic Rock
Complete Level 5 in Classic Mode

Action Hero
Complete Level 5 in Action Mode

Casual Carat
Complete Level 10 in Endless mode

Detonator
Destroy 12 gems in a single move

Diamonds are Forever
Make 3 blue matches in a row

Jewel Keeper
Clear 5,000 gems

100K Club
Score 100,000 in Action Mode or Classic Mode

Silver

Six Shooter
Get a 6x Cascade

Powermad
Create 200 Power Gems

Hypercube Hoarder
Create 50 Hypercubes

Dimensional Rift
Have 5 Hypercubes on the game board

Gold

Puzzlemaster
Complete Puzzle Mode

I've just stumbled across a glitch on Bejeweled 2 that could prove quite useful.

Basically, I was playing Action mode earlier when I had to go out, so, mid-game I switched off the PS3.

When I got back, I fired up Bejeweled 2 and had completely forgotten about my previous game. I was asked if I wanted to continue from my previous game – I selected yes. However, the timer along the bottom had reset to the middle, whilst maintaining the level I had reached.

To confirm this, I let the timer run right down to the red, selected 'Quit game' via the PS button, quit the game to the xmb, then reloaded the game, and the timer had reset again. 

So if you're ever about to run out of time on a level, you can simply quit out and the timer will reset, but you can potentially never lose on Action mode (if you can be bothered to quit out every time you're about to fail that is).

This is also worked on Endless mode. No one had topped up the leccy metre in our house, so we had the power cut from our house, and obviously the PS3 went off. I was a bit pissed off as I was very close to getting the trophy for reaching level 10 in Endless mode. When we (finally) topped up the eletricity, and I got back to my game I saw that I was still on level 10, albeit at the start of the level. Seems to be a very useful, if not overly generous autosave system.

freezebug2 said:

Post edited 7:37 pm – May 15, 2009 by freezebug2


A handy glitch for anyone struggling, but the trophies arent too challenging anyway apart from the last silver one which I was unable to get….five hypercubes on one board, i have managed four but that was flukey so if you can find a glitch for that then it would be much appreciated.


Quit the game when you get 3 or 4, then copy your save onto a memory stick because it will have autosaved. Then carry on with your game as normal and if you mess up then you can copy the save from the memory stick back onto the PS3 and try again.
